Planning for the Inevitable: Embracing Failure

First off, let’s have a little heart-to-heart about this funny idea of designing for failure. Sounds a bit wacky, right? Like trying to teach a goldfish to ride a bike—just doesn’t add up! But don’t sweat it! In the cloud world, it’s not about asking for trouble; it’s about being savvy enough to know that things can go sideways and getting ready to dodge the big disasters.

Imagine this: it’s a regular Tuesday, you’ve got your coffee, and you’re scribbling down your to-do list when Bob from IT bursts in, looking like he’s just seen a ghost—"The server's down!" If your cloud architecture is on point, this should be more like a minor bump in the road instead of a full-blown meltdown. With redundancy and backups in your corner, AWS ensures that if one part of the puzzle goes a bit wonky, the rest keep rolling along. Think of it as a well-equipped toolbox; if one tool breaks, you’ve got a whole bunch ready to step in.

The Power of Decoupling: Finding Flexibility

Then we have the chunky monoliths—those big, clunky applications where everything’s all tangled up like a bowl of spaghetti. They might hold strong until they don’t (cue suspenseful music). On the flip side, we’ve got those nimble microservices—little champs, always primed to jump into action.

Decoupling is all about breaking down the architecture into smaller, manageable chunks. Each piece can grow independently—no need to wreck the whole thing just to add a new button. Plus, this strategy ramps up resilience. In a decoupled setup, if one service stumbles, the others keep cruising along, no problem. It’s like running a relay race, where each runner has their own baton instead of sharing one, just in case someone decides to take a breather.

Elasticity in the Cloud: The Magic of Scalability

Think of elasticity in the cloud as those comfy stretchy pants you pull on during the holidays. The beauty is the ability to stretch and shrink to meet changing demands. When traffic spikes like a viral TikTok dance, cloud elasticity means your application adapts without breaking a sweat. Resources can be cranked up quickly, and when the buzz dies down, they can easily scale back down. This means you only pay for what you truly use. Security in the Cloud: Your Safe Space

Now, let’s dive into security. You might picture the cloud as a sunny little village, but it’s really more like a well-guarded castle. AWS takes security seriously, working under a shared responsibility model where they handle the security of the cloud infrastructure, while you keep your prized possessions safe inside.

With tools like Identity and Access Management (IAM), ironclad data encryption, and detailed logging mechanisms, AWS provides a treasure trove of resources to help bolster your infrastructure.
